Hi, I’m Carlie, the voice behind Unapologetically Forgiven. I’m a believer, encourager, and lifelong learner who’s experienced the radical, healing power of God’s grace—and I’m passionate about creating space for others to encounter that same freedom. This podcast was born from a deep desire to share the truth of God’s Word in a way that’s honest, heartfelt, and unfiltered.

Whether you’re walking through a season of doubt, healing from your past, or just seeking a quiet place to reconnect with God, you’re welcome here. Through Scripture, personal stories, and real conversations, my hope is that every episode reminds you that you are loved, chosen, and—above all—unapologetically forgiven.

    In this episode, we dive into where God calls a reluctant prophet and confronts a nation drifting from truth. From Jeremiah’s commissioning to God’s urgent warnings, these chapters reveal the cost of ignoring conviction and the depth of God’s desire for repentance. Together, we reflect on calling, courage, and what it means to speak truth—even when it’s uncomfortable and unpopular.

    In this episode, we explore where human smallness meets the vastness of God’s power. As Bildad speaks of God’s holiness and Job responds with awe-filled descriptions of creation, we’re reminded of the tension between our limited understanding and God’s unmatched sovereignty. Together, we reflect on humility, reverence, and trusting a God whose greatness goes far beyond what we can see—or explain.
